Drug toxicity and safety assessment from "summary" of Chemistry for Pharmacy Students by Lutfun Nahar,Professor Satyajit D. Sarker
Drug toxicity and safety assessment play a crucial role in the field of pharmacy. It involves evaluating the potential risks and side effects of a drug to ensure its safety for human consumption. This process is essential to protect patients from harmful effects and to ensure the effectiveness of the medication. Toxicity assessment involves studying the toxic effects of a drug on living organisms, including humans. This assessment helps determine the safe dosage of a drug and identify any potential risks associated with its use. By understanding the toxic effects of a drug, healthcare professionals can make informed decisions about its administration and monitor patients for any adverse reactions. Safety assessment, on the other hand, focuses on evaluating the overall safety profile of a drug. This assessment considers factors such as drug interactions, contraindications, and potential side effects. By assessing the safety of a drug, healthcare professionals can minimize the risk of harm to patients and ensure the best possible outcomes. In drug development, toxicity and safety assessment are conducted at various stages, including preclinical and clinical trials. During preclinical trials, researchers evaluate the toxic effects of a drug in laboratory settings using cell cultures and animal models. This helps identify any potential risks before the drug is tested in humans. In clinical trials, the safety and efficacy of a drug are evaluated in human subjects. These trials help determine the appropriate dosage, identify any adverse reactions, and assess the overall safety of the drug. By monitoring patients closely during clinical trials, researchers can gather valuable data on the drug's safety profile and make any necessary adjustments to ensure its safety and effectiveness.- Drug toxicity and safety assessment are critical aspects of pharmacy practice. By carefully evaluating the potential risks and side effects of a drug, healthcare professionals can ensure the safety and well-being of patients. This process helps inform treatment decisions and protect patients from harm, ultimately improving the quality of care in pharmacy settings.
